Power Supply
Connect the co ee machine only to a suitable socket. The volt-
age must correspond to that indicated on the appliance label.
Power Cord
Never use the co ee machine if the power cord is defective or
damaged. If the power cord is damaged, it must be replaced
by the manufacturer or by its authorised service centre. Do not
pass the power cord around corners, over sharp edges or over
hot objects and keep it away from oil.
Do not use the power cord to carry or pull the co ee machine.
Do not pull out the plug by the power cord or touch it with wet
hands. Do not let the power cord hang freely from tables or
shelves.
For the Safety of Others
Prevent children from playing with the machine. Children are
not aware of the risks related to electrical household appli-
ances. Do not leave the machine packaging materials within
the reach of children.
Danger of burns
Never direct jets of overheated steam and/or hot water to-
wards yourself or others. Do not touch the steam wand with
bare hands. Always use the handles or knobs provided.
Do not disconnect (remove) the pressurized  lter holder while
co ee is brewed. Hot water drips may spill out of the brew unit
during the warm-up phase. Do not touch the brew unit when
the machine is on or before it cools down.
Location
Place the co ee machine in a safe place, where there will be no
danger of overturning or injury. Hot water or overheated steam
may spill out of the machine: danger of scalding!
Do not keep the machine at a temperature below 0°C. Frost
may damage it.
Do not use the co ee machine outdoors. In order to prevent
its housing from melting or being damaged, do not place the
machine on very hot surfaces and close to open  ames.
Cleaning
Before cleaning the machine, turn it o by pressing the ON/OFF
button, then remove the plug from the socket. Wait also for the
machine to cool down.
Never immerse the machine in water!
It is strictly forbidden to tamper with the internal parts of the
machine. Water left in the tank for several days should not be
consumed. Wash the tank and  ll it with fresh drinking water.

Storing the Machine
If the machine is to remain inactive for a long time, turn it o
and unplug it. Store the machine in a dry place, out of the reach
of children. Keep it protected from dust and dirt. Do not keep
the machine at a temperature below 0°C. Frost may damage it.
Repairs / Maintenance
In case of failure, problems or a suspected fault resulting from
the falling of the machine, immediately remove the plug from
the socket. Never attempt to operate a faulty machine. Servic-
ing and repairs may only be carried out by Authorised Service
Centres. All liability for damages resulting from work not car-
ried out by professionals is declined.
Fire Safety Precautions
In case of  re, use carbon dioxide (CO
2
) extinguishers. Do not
use water or dry powder extinguishers.
